Description
A Reliable Foundation for Productive Pastures
The 'Kazarovitska' bromegrass (smooth brome) is a variety developed by the Kyiv State Agricultural Research Station, specifically bred for the diverse climatic conditions of Ukraine. Unlike intensive imported varieties that may require delicate handling, 'Kazarovitska' offers robustness and reliability for long-term forage production.
Key Advantages and Agrotechnics
The core strength of this variety lies in its longevity and rapid recovery after grazing or mowing. It establishes a vigorous root system, which is crucial for soil structure and moisture retention, making it an excellent choice for stabilizing pastures. Main highlights include:
- High Nutritional Value: Provides high-protein green mass, essential for both dairy and meat livestock.
- Climate Resilience: Proven tolerance to spring frosts and seasonal dry spells, ensuring stable yields even in challenging years.
- Durability: A perennial stand that maintains productivity for up to 7–10 years, minimizing the need for frequent re-seeding.
Target Audience and Best Practices
This variety is the optimal choice for farm operations focusing on sustainable forage management. 'Kazarovitska' performs exceptionally well in meadows and pastures where longevity and consistent performance are prioritized. While it is highly adaptable, it responds significantly to moderate nitrogen fertilization during the early growth stages, which helps unlock its full potential for biomass production.
